Output d7598a610758dea18113446c2e6045c03123bb66ff913dea6f03837ddf49fc3a:0

value
4045660442
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1f704d194b5840a8ee00300c232e1e4a0b939ed OP_EQUALVERIFY OP_CHECKSIG
address
DTCVJf8hwcQp89ShAUbM6jZxc38NKJAJcn
transaction
d7598a610758dea18113446c2e6045c03123bb66ff913dea6f03837ddf49fc3a